The Limulus Amebocyte Lysate (LAL) assay is Just about the most broadly used procedures because of its higher sensitivity. This assay leverages the organic reaction of horseshoe crab blood cells to endotoxins, resulting in gel clot development. Whilst efficient, the LAL assay can at times generate Bogus positives because of non-unique reactions with certain polysaccharides.

Together, these info have led to your so-called “PEZ Model” of Lpt-mediated LPS transport (146). This design likens LPS to your at first Austrian PEZ candies, and the Lpt transportation equipment into the mechanical PEZ sweet dispenser invented by Oskar Uxa. This kind of dispenser performs By the use of a spring-loaded platform at the base from the dispenser, which pushes a stack of PEZ candies up throughout the central channel on the dispenser, making sure that a sweet is usually current with the exit with the dispenser and ready to be taken and consumed from the person. Furthermore, this design predicts that LPS travels being a stream of molecules, and which the driving pressure of LPS transport from the Lpt equipment is derived with the LptB2FG transporter at the base from the periplasmic channel formed by LptCAD.
